I just got mine Bushman Harmonica and wanted to give everyone my impression.
A little background on my experience and abilities:
I am a beginner to intermediate player. Trying to get my tongue slapping down. Currently working through some of Dave Barrett's instructional material.
I have tried several different harmonicas.
Huang Star Performer Hohner Blues Harp Hohner Marine Band Hohner Big River Lee Oskar
I have played with gapping and 3M Micropore Tape and have improved sound & playability of some of the above, but, I have come up with nothing that plays better and sounds as good as the Bushman harmonica.
It is very comfortable in the mouth for working on the Tongue Blocking (Slapping).
It is easier to play the my Lee Oskar.
It sounds great. Previously I was very dismayed listening to myself playing along with Dave Barrett's CD's. My tone just sounded awful compared to his. I Just got done playing along using the Bushman. It made a world of difference.
